Utah beat Houston 81-67 to cut the Rockets' series lead to 2-1.

But more important, the Rockets set a few (terrible) playoff records.

Fewest points in a half: 25 (2nd half)

Fewest points in a game: 67

Fewest FG made: 21

and craziest of all

Fewest players to score in a game: four...yes, F-O-U-R (T-Mac, Yao, Battier, and Alston)
